Cemex completes $36m aggregate terminal expansion at Port Tampa Bay to serve Florida construction demand

Mexican building materials group Cemex and Port Tampa Bay have completed a $36m (€33m) expansion of a marine aggregate terminal in Florida, boosting the supply of raw construction materials into one of the US's fastest-growing construction markets. The project includes a $29m (€26.6m) investment from Cemex and a $7m (€6.4m) grant from the Florida Department of Transportation.

Tampa Bay Business and Wealth reported that the expansion was marked by a ribbon-cutting ceremony attended by Cemex executives, Port Tampa Bay officials and Tampa Mayor Jane Castor. The facility will import crushed stone aggregate from Newfoundland, Canada, through Port Tampa Bay's deepwater berths via a conveying system capable of moving 5,000 tons per hour from ship to storage, with an expected annual throughput of approximately 1.5 million tons.

The expanded terminal combines an aggregate terminal, cement terminal and ready-mix concrete plant in a single integrated location, making it the only operation of its kind in Cemex's Florida network. The development comes as builders across the state face increasing pressure to secure reliable aggregate supply amid a sustained pipeline of apartment, industrial, transportation and public works schemes across the Tampa Bay region.

Jesus Gonzalez, president of Cemex US, said: "The completion of our Aggregate Terminal at Port Tampa Bay strengthens Cemex's ability to serve one of Florida's fastest-growing regions with the essential materials needed to build and maintain critical infrastructure."

Paul Anderson, president and CEO of Port Tampa Bay, said: "Port Tampa Bay is proud to support Cemex's growing operations and the broader Tampa Bay economy."
